We’ve missed Bailies Bar at Warner’s Hotel which used to be the venue for much socialising. Sadly the building was a victim of the earthquakes. A new Bailies Bar has just opened in the Edgeware Village, and all the memorabilia from the old Bailies is there.
We’ve shifted our Sunday afternoon session to the new Bailies, because Pomeroy’s has now become so popular and noisy that it’s no longer pleasant. Bailies is already proving popular – if that becomes noisy too I’m not sure where we’ll go. It was good to meet a number of old Bailies friends again.
